155. Property of deceased seaman left abroad but not on board ship.- If any seaman or apprentice on an Indian ship, or engaged in India on any other ship, the voyage of hitches to terminate in India, dies at any place outside India leaving any money or effects not on board the ship, the Indian consular officer at or near the place shall claim and take charge of such money and other effects (hereinafter referred to as the property of a deceased seaman or apprentice). | ||||||
